Algebra Properties Used in Geometry
Postulates of Equality
For any real numbers a, b, and c:
Reflexive Property of Equality: a = a
Symmetric Property of Equality: If a = b, then b = a.
Transitive Property of Equality: If a = b and b = c, then a = c.
Postulates of Equality and Operations
For any real numbers a, b, and c:
Addition Property of Equality: If a = b, the a + b = b + c
Multiplication Property of Equality: If a = b, then ac = bc.
Postulates of Inequality and Operations
For any real numbers a, b, and c:
Transitive Property of Inequality: If a < b and b < c, then a < c.
Addition Property of Inequality: If a < b, then a + c < b + c
Multiplication Properties of Inequality: If a < b and c > 0, then ac < bc.
Postulates of Equality and Inequality
For any real numbers a, b, and c:
Equation to Inequality Property: If and b are positive numbers and
a + b = c, then c > a and c > b.
Substitution Property: If a = b, then a may be substituted for b in
any expression.
